Output 17f178a73f17f03239fc31b6c8a61b7905d38839a36dbbdd2fdc0a1bcd94bda4:1

value
3358867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19743a57bb56825f4a60bad1d606fab3653599fa OP_EQUAL
address
341c3zhffzuTMGrACQU67kNNZuXFkJjjKZ
transaction
17f178a73f17f03239fc31b6c8a61b7905d38839a36dbbdd2fdc0a1bcd94bda4
spent
true